免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

小程序开发工具安装图

小程序是一种轻量级的应用形式,其依托于微信及相关服务的支持,为用户提供简单、易用的应用交互方式。小程序开发工具则是开发人员创建和开发小程序的主要工具,它提供了小程序开发所需的各种便捷工具和功能。本文将详细介绍小程序开发工具的安装方式及其原理。

一、小程序开发工具的安装方式

小程序开发工具是一款免费软件,它支持在 Windows、MacOS 等多个平台上运行。以下是小程序开发工具安装的详细步骤:

1. 下载小程序开发工具

首先需要进入官方网站(https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html),点击“下载小程序开发工具”按钮。

2. 安装小程序开发工具

下载完毕后,运行下载好的开发工具安装程序。按照提示操作,完成对开发工具的安装。

3. 打开小程序开发工具

安装完成后,双击小程序开发工具图标即可打开开发工具。在首页选择“新建小程序”或“导入小程序”后,即可开始开发工作。

二、小程序开发工具的原理介绍

小程序开发工具一般分为两大模块:IDE 和调试工具。

1. IDE 模块

IDE(Integrated Development Environment)是指集成开发环境,是开发者维护和开发项目的一个集成式工具。小程序开发工具中的 IDE 模块主要负责代码编辑、上传等工作。

(1) 代码编辑器

小程序开发工具的 IDE 模块内置一个支持多种编程语言的代码编辑器,主要用于编写小程序的代码。IDE 中的代码编辑器不仅具备编码智能提示、代码高亮、错误提示等基本功能,还支持整合 Git 版本控制工具。这意味着开发者可以将其小程序代码上传到 Git 仓库中,便于进行版本控制和团队协作。

(2) 上传工具

小程序开发工具提供了一套完善的上传工具,支持将开发者编写的小程序代码快速上传到微信服务器。开发者需要先在开发工具中绑定小程序的 AppID,然后选择上传代码、上传预览版本、上传正式版本等功能,按照顺序操作即可。

2. 调试工具模块

调试工具模块主要负责小程序的实时调试和查错,帮助开发者快速定位并解决小程序应用中的问题。

(1) 页面渲染工具

小程序开发工具的调试工具集成了一个页面渲染器,支持实时渲染小程序中的页面,展示页面效果和布局样式。开发者可以通过调试工具切换不同小程序页面,模拟用户体验,预先体验小程序的功能效果等。

(2) 调试信息展示

小程序开发工具的调试工具会自动监听小程序运行时的调试信息,并将其实时展示在调试面板中。开发者可以通过调试信息定位小程序中的问题,或者调试功能代码,更好地优化其开发工作流程。

以上便是小程序开发工具的安装及其原理介绍。开发者可以通过学习这些内容,更好地利用小程序开发工具开发出符合用户需要的微信小程序应用。


相关知识:
阿里钉钉小程序开发要钱吗
阿里钉钉小程序是一款基于阿里钉钉平台的应用程序,它可以在钉钉企业内部员工之间进行快速的数据传递和通信。小程序使用HTML5、CSS3、Javascript等技术栈开发,具有轻量、快速、跨平台、兼容性好等特点,被广泛应用于企业级应用的开发中。阿里钉钉小程序开
2023-08-09
安卓开发小程序闪退
安卓开发小程序闪退是指在运行安卓开发小程序时出现了程序异常崩溃等情况导致程序无法正常运行。这种问题在开发过程中经常遇到,一旦出现就需要开发者快速定位并解决。本文将从原理和详细介绍两个方面进行阐述。一、原理安卓开发小程序闪退的原因多种多样,其中比较常见的原因
2023-08-09
window常用小程序开发
Windows平台下的小程序开发主要是以微软开发的Universal Windows Platform(简称UWP)为主。UWP是一种面向各种Windows设备(包括PC、Surface、手机、Xbox等)开发应用程序的框架,具有跨设备、本地化、可更新、易
2023-08-09
web前端开发与微信小程序哪个好
Web前端开发和微信小程序都是目前比较热门的领域。Web前端开发是构建Web应用的前端技术,主要涉及HTML、CSS、JavaScript等语言;而微信小程序则是微信平台的一种应用形态,通过微信客户端进行访问和使用,主要使用HTML、CSS、JavaScr
2023-08-09
vux开发微信小程序
Vux是一个基于Vue.js的组件库,目前已被广泛应用于Web开发。在微信小程序中,我们也可以使用Vux来开发我们的小程序。下面将介绍如何在微信小程序中使用Vux:1. 安装Vux可以使用npm来安装Vux,命令如下:```npm install vux
2023-08-09
h5游戏开发小程序
HTML5是一种用于构建Web内容的语言。H5游戏开发利用了HTML5技术来实现基于Web的游戏,并在近年来快速成长为新兴市场。而小程序则是一种无需下载安装即可直接使用的小应用程序。H5游戏开发小程序的基本原理是,使用小程序作为前端开发环境,基于HTML5
2023-08-09
elisp开发小程序
Emacs Lisp(简称elisp)是一种基于Lisp的语言,它是GNU Emacs编辑器的扩展语言。Elisp程序可以在Emacs环境下运行,并利用Emacs提供的编辑和交互功能,开发和使用Emacs的各种插件。在本篇文章中,我们将为大家详细介绍eli
2023-08-09
eas开发之接口小程序下
在 EAS 开发中,接口小程序是一个非常重要的实现方式,它可以方便地将 EAS 与其他系统进行整合和联接,从而实现更广泛的应用。下面,我们来详细介绍一下接口小程序的相关知识点及其原理。一、接口小程序的概念接口小程序是 EAS 中的一个特殊应用程序,其主要作
2023-08-09
ai赋能小程序商城开发
随着互联网的快速发展,移动互联网也逐渐成为人们日常生活中必不可少的一部分。同时,人工智能( AI )的应用也越来越广泛,为传统的商场及线上商城注入了无限的潜能。而小程序作为一种新兴的互联网产品,不仅具有轻量化、便捷等特点,也为商家提供了一个全新的销售渠道。
2023-08-09
小程序开发工具扫码
小程序开发工具扫码指的是在使用微信小程序开发工具时,通过扫描有特殊二维码的手机可以在电脑上进行小程序代码的编辑、调试、预览和上传等工作。下面将针对小程序开发工具扫码的原理和详细介绍进行说明。一、小程序开发工具扫码原理小程序开发工具扫码原理是通过将手机上的扫
2023-05-26
腾讯小程序开发工具
腾讯小程序开发工具是一款基于微信小程序开发的集成开发环境(IDE),使用该工具可以直接在电脑上进行小程序的开发、测试、调试、预览和上传等操作,极大的提高了小程序的开发效率和开发质量。腾讯小程序开发工具支持Windows、macOS和Linux操作系统,提供
2023-05-26
美颜小程序开发工具有哪些
美颜小程序是近年来非常流行的一种应用,随着人们对美的要求日益增加,很多人开始追求自己在社交网络上的美颜效果。为了满足用户的需求,很多开发者开始设计出美颜小程序,这些小程序凭借其实用性和便捷性,越来越受到广大用户的欢迎。那么,美颜小程序是如何开发出来的呢?一
2023-05-26